This paper describes the development of a satellite design process and its implementation within a process guidance tool (Process Steering Tool – ProST) for the work within a design center environment (Satellite Design Office – SDO). Process and tool have been developed at the Institute of Astronautics (LRT) of the Technische Universität München in cooperation with EADS Astrium Ottobrunn within the BaiCES project (Bavarian Center of Excellence for Satellite Constellation Systems) partially funded by the Bayerische Forschungsstiftung BFS. The work presented in this paper was based on two major aspects, the design center concept and the satellite design process. The paper emphasizes a new way of process guidance, using a web based tool support, against the background of these aspects. The authors present the overall process development and guidance approach, in particular the design and implementation of the satellite design center process within the process steering tool and the process guidance provided by the tool. The paper also highlights the evolution from the idea of developing a HTML based process guidance demonstrator to a dynamic PHP/mySQL based tool. It also shows that this approach is well suited for the guidance of a design center team through a development process. The usability and flexibility of this process was shown during a satellite design workshop at the Institute of Astronautics. At the end of the paper the next steps of the process and tool development will be presented.
